你查询的IP:[116.192.135.61]  地理位置:中国–上海–上海电信

最新查询119.232.12.226 221.176.17.250 118.212.20.235 118.228.79.153 222.240.59.219 124.200.95.251 118.66.144.160 124.67.234.235 59.108.153.234 116.128.116.57 116.192.135.61 58.100.17.177 60.245.128.115 121.48.123.13 119.161.128.98 203.135.160.31 120.32.132.3 202.170.216.251 202.91.128.243 114.64.244.136 120.148.126.188 221.14.86.11 119.254.58.15 121.255.235.29 203.212.80.74 202.14.235.231 202.38.128.252 202.136.48.187 119.162.58.191 61.8.160.54 122.3.128.76 121.140.16.161